Downspout Cleaning in Long Island, NY
Downspout cleaning services involve removing debris, dirt, and obstructions from the downspouts and connected drainage systems to ensure proper water flow away from the property. This service typically covers residential projects such as clearing clogged or overflowing downspouts, inspecting for damage or leaks, and ensuring that the entire gutter system functions effectively during heavy rain. Property owners often want to understand whether their downspouts are directing water safely away from the foundation, if there are any signs of rust or deterioration, and whether routine cleaning is recommended to prevent water damage or basement flooding.
Homeowners requesting downspout cleaning usually seek to maintain the integrity of their gutter systems and prevent issues caused by blockages. It’s useful to know if the project involves extending or repairing downspouts, especially in areas prone to heavy rain or pooling water. Clarifying the scope of work-such as whether the service includes inspecting the entire gutter system or just cleaning accessible sections-can help property owners plan for effective water management and avoid costly repairs caused by neglected drainage.

Common Downspout Cleaning Jobs
Downspout cleaning - removes debris to prevent water overflow and foundation damage.
Clog removal - clears blockages caused by leaves, twigs, and dirt.
Gutter downspout flushing - ensures proper water flow through the entire system.
Exterior inspection - checks for damage or leaks that could compromise drainage.
Downspout extension installation - directs water away from the foundation for added protection.
Routine maintenance - helps maintain effective drainage and prolongs gutter system life.
Downspout Cleaning Questions
Why should downspouts be cleaned regularly? Regular cleaning prevents clogs that can cause water damage, foundation issues, and basement flooding.
How often should downspouts be serviced? It is recommended to have downspouts checked and cleaned at least twice a year, typically in spring and fall.
What signs indicate downspouts need cleaning? Signs include water overflowing during rain, visible debris, or pooling around the foundation.
Can downspout cleaning prevent property damage? Yes, keeping downspouts clear helps direct water away from the property, reducing the risk of damage.
